Psalms 119:45 I will live in perfect freedom, because I try to obey Your teachings.

A wise woman once said... “Your life is not more important to you than it is to God” ~ Ebele Light

And the wisest man who ever lived (besides Jesus) said... “There is a way that seemeth right unto a man, but the end thereof are the ways of death” (Proverbs 16:25).

Photo from Instagram by @weareyen

How many times have we shunned the Lord’s instructions because we didn’t see the “sense” in it at that particular moment? We think within our hearts that He doesn’t understand what’s at stake. We think we know what’s best, that He’s not familiar with the times and He’s taking away the fun part of life. He should understand, we say...

But much more than the actual instructions though, I reckon that the reason for our rebellion is our frail understanding of how God sees us.

The psalmist said, “How precious are Your thoughts to me”. Even as Jesus earnestly said, “Look at the birds: they do not sow seeds, gather a harvest and put in barns; yet your Father in heaven takes care of them! Aren’t you worth much more than birds?”

How did we get to the point of thinking God has anything less than the best planned out for us? When did we settle in our hearts that the ways of God are against us? We recite Jeremiah 29:11 as we stand in the church pews but once we step out and the Lord says take left, we turn right. Why? Who has lied to us and why have we believed it?

The commandments of God do not limit our freedom but perfect it; in the sense that it keeps us from derailing! Consider the passengers in a train that has gone off track, they do not shout in glee and claim “freedom” from the railway that’s to take them to their destination, instead they shudder in fear! But we do the exact opposite.

I repeat again in frustration, who has taught us to delight in the path that leads to death!? Who??

You’re God’s little guy/baby girl. The heir to His entire Kingdom. You can never care about yourself as much as He does for you. You are the apple of His eyes. He will never lead you to your ruin! Read the Bible, anyone who had a bad ending did exactly what we’re doing in this generation — they turned away from the Truth.

What we need now is sincere repentance and walking genuinely with the Lord. Forget shame! Na pesin wey dey alive get shame (it is he who is alive that is capable of feeling shame). All else outside Christ is fear, bondage and death in every sense. Please choose life!

Referring back now to the words of the psalmist in Psalms 139:17 that says, “How precious are Your thoughts to me”. We must fill ourselves with the thoughts God has of us. Only then will we honour His leadings, have faith in His promises, trust processes, reverence His Word and realize that He breaks only to make us (consider the works of a potter). Only when we see ourselves as He does will we see the depth of His love for us (and respond ever so fervently).
